WebIf blood flow to your feet is reduced, the damaged tissues don’t get as much oxygen. When this occurs, cell metabolism slows down, which reduces your body’s ability to fight of infection and close the wound. This painful condition is often related to the chronic tugging of a tight … WebNov 7, 2024 · You should be referred to a specialist podiatrist and / or vascular service to look into why your foot wound is not healing. Treatment may involve: Specialist footwear and / or insoles. Removal of any dead tissue (debridement) Dressings. Exploration of any other medical conditions. Antibiotics – only if the wound is infected.
